Abstract
The utility model discloses superhard laminate sheet mini-pore boring cutter, including fixed handle, it is characterized in that, the top of the fixed handle is provided with fixing groove, positioning hole is provided with the both sides side wall of fixing groove, two positioning holes are asymmetric to be set, positioning hole internal thread is connected with jackscrew, fixing groove is internally connected with vertically disposed first knife bar, resilient sleeve is provided between first knife bar and fixed handle, resilient sleeve is connected in fixing groove, one end of jackscrew extends to the inside of resilient sleeve through the side wall of resilient sleeve, the teeth groove of array arrangement is provided with the top side wall of fixed handle, the adjustment ring of annular is welded with the lateral wall of first knife bar, adjustment ring is provided with the tooth mouth of array arrangement close to the side side wall of fixed handle, tooth mouth is intermeshed with the teeth groove on fixed handle.The utility model is simple in construction, convenient disassembly, and cutter head direction can be finely adjusted, convenient cutting.

Operation principle:When being installed, the interference of fixed handle 1 is connected or is connected on lathe upper tool post, by elastic rubber
Gum cover 9 is connected in the fixing groove 10 on fixed handle 1, and the fixture block 1 that elastic caoutchouc covers 9 bottoms is connected in neck, then by first
Knife bar 8 is fixed in fixing groove 10, is rotated adjustment ring 5, is adjusted the direction of cutter head, facilitate it to be cut, after adjusting so that
Tooth mouth 51 is intermeshed with teeth groove 11, then first knife bar 8 is fixed by jackscrew 4.
